Total Student Population Comparison
The total student population of selected colleges is 14,769 with 9,356 female students and 5,413 male students. This enrollment statistics is based on the latest data from IPEDS, U.S. Department of Education for academic year 2022-2023. The following table compares the student population for both undergraduate and graduate schools between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, Seattle University has the most enrolled students of 7,121, while Northwest University has the least number of students of 1,014 for both in graduate and undergraduate programs.
Name | Total | Men | Women |
---|---|---|---|
Northwest University | 1,014 | 354 | 660 |
University of Puget Sound | 2,023 | 814 | 1,209 |
Seattle Pacific University | 3,118 | 976 | 2,142 |
Seattle University | 7,121 | 2,617 | 4,504 |
Whitman College | 1,493 | 652 | 841 |
Columbia College - Whidbey Island | - | - | - |
Total | 14,769 | 5,413 | 9,356 |
Undergraduate Student Population
The total undergraduate population of selected colleges is 10,403 with 6,389 female students and 4,014 male students. The following table compares 2022-2023 undergraduate enrollment between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, Seattle University has the most enrolled undergraduate students of 4,046, while Northwest University has the least number of undergraduate students of 720.
Name | Total | Men | Women |
---|---|---|---|
Northwest University | 720 | 251 | 469 |
University of Puget Sound | 1,712 | 727 | 985 |
Seattle Pacific University | 2,432 | 796 | 1,636 |
Seattle University | 4,046 | 1,588 | 2,458 |
Whitman College | 1,493 | 652 | 841 |
Total | 10,403 | 4,014 | 6,389 |
Graduate Student Population
The total graduate population of selected colleges is 4,366 with 2,967 female students and 1,399 male students. The following table compares 2022-2023 graduate enrollment between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, Seattle University has the most enrolled graduate students of 3,075, while Northwest University has the least number of graduate students of 294.
Name | Total | Men | Women |
---|---|---|---|
Northwest University | 294 | 103 | 191 |
University of Puget Sound | 311 | 87 | 224 |
Seattle Pacific University | 686 | 180 | 506 |
Seattle University | 3,075 | 1,029 | 2,046 |
Total | 4,366 | 1,399 | 2,967 |
